PONTE VEDRA BEACH, Fla. - North Florida men's golf defended its home course after edging Charlotte out by one stroke to stand victorious at The Hayt on Monday afternoon. This is the program's first win at The Hayt since 2017 and their fifth title since the tournament started in 1992.
The Ospreys took a one-stroke lead heading to the 18th hole with Charlotte creeping up on first place.
Robbie Higgins came in the clutch with a long chip that sat within inches of the pin to all but secure the title for the Ospreys at Sawgrass Country Club.
Nick Gabrelcik carded his second round under par on the weekend to earn a share of the individual title with LSU's Drew Doyle. He won his second consecutive medalist crown at The Hayt and has placed first in all four tournaments hosted on the First Coast.

ROUND REFLECTIONS
- Gabrelcik continues to rack up the accolades this season with his sixth top-10 finish, his fifth tournament under par and his second medalist crown.
- He is also the sixth individual title winner for the Ospreys at The Hayt and only the second UNF golfer to go back-to-back since David Bennett in 2000-01.
- Higgins made the title-clinching chip and putt on the final hole to finish his weekend in third-place at 5-under 211, which matches his career-best round of 54.
- His top-three placement is the best finish of his career, as well as the second time this season that he's placed in the top 10.
- It is the fifth time in the history of The Hayt that UNF had two golfers place within the top-three spots.
